Cooling System Classifications

Electric motors generate heat because of electrical and mechanical losses. Cooling is necessary to continuously transfer the heat to a cooling medium, such as the air. In AC induction motors, the cooling air is usually circulated internally and externally by one or more fans mounted on the rotor shaft. The cooling method classification used by the IEC is the index of cooling (IC), the classes are provided below.
